#0d4333 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0d4333 is composed of 5.1% red, 26.3%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.9% yellow and 73.7% black. It has a hue angle of 162.2 degrees, a saturation of 67.5% and a lightness of 15.7%. #0d4333 color hex could be obtained by blending #1a8666 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003333.

Shades and Tints of #0d4333

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f0fc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#0d4333

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#262a29 is the less saturated color, while #014f38 is the most saturated one.
